See this document in CiteSeerX!

Evaluation of Regular Nonlinear Recursions by Deductive Database Techniques (1995)  (Make Corrections)  (2 citations)
Jiawei Han, et al.
Information Systems



  Home/Search   Context   Related

 
View or download:
cs.concordia.ca/pu...nfoSystems94.ps.gz
cs.concordia.ca/pu...nfoSystems94.ps.gz
Cached:  PS.gz  PS  PDF   Image  Update  Help

From:  cs.concordia.ca/~faculty...papers (more)
(Enter author homepages)

Rate this article: (best)
  Comment on this article  
(Enter summary)

Abstract: Nonlinear recursion is one of the most challenging classes of logic programs for efficient evaluation in logic programming systems. We identify one popular class of nonlinear recursion, regular nonlinear recursion, and investigate its efficient implementation by a deductive database approach. The approach performs a detailed query binding analysis based on query information, constraint information and the structure of a recursion, selects an appropriate predicate evaluation order and generates... (Update)

Context of citations to this paper:   More

.... our method is also applicable to the evaluation of more general class of recursions such as nested linear and non linear recursions [12, 5]. Instead of transforming DOOD programs into Horn like programs, the DOOD programs are preprocessed into normalized forms. The...

.... a; b; c; a to b; a to c; b to c; a to b; c to a; c to b; a to b] can still be analyzed systematically and be evaluated efficiently [8]. However, this does not imply that chain based evaluation can be applied effectively to all kinds of recursions. This is because some...

Cited by:   More
LogicBase: A Deductive Database System Prototype - Han, Liu, Xie (1994)   (Correct)
Normalization and Compilation of Deductive and Object-Oriented.. - Xie, Han (1995)   (Correct)

Similar documents (at the sentence level):
78.3%:   Evaluation of Regular Nonlinear Recursions by Deductive.. - Han, Lakshmanan (1995)   (Correct)

Active bibliography (related documents):   More   All
0.8:   Constraint-Based Query Evaluation in Deductive Databases - Han (1994)   (Correct)
0.6:   Chain-Split Evaluation in Deductive Databases - Han (1995)   (Correct)
0.6:   Evaluation of Declarative N-Queens Recursion: A Deductive.. - Han, Liu, Lu   (Correct)

Similar documents based on text:   More   All
0.5:   From a Polynomial Riemann Hypothesis to Alternating Sign.. - Egecioglu, Redmond   (Correct)
0.4:   A Fixpoint Theory for Non-monotonic Parallelism - Chen (2001)   (Correct)
0.3:   Conjugate Gradient Algorithms Using Multiple Recursions - Barth, Manteuffel (1995)   (Correct)

Related documents from co-citation:   More   All
2:   HiLog: A Foundation for Higher-Order Logic Programming - Chen, Kifer et al. - 1989
2:   Automatic generation of compiled forms for linear recursions (context) - Han, Zeng - 1992
2:   XSB as an efficient deductive database engine - Sagonas, Swift et al. - 1994

BibTeX entry:   (Update)

J. Han and L. V. S. Lakshmanan. Evaluation of regular nonlinear recursions by deductive database techniques. Information Systems, 20, 1995 (to appear). http://citeseer.ist.psu.edu/article/han95evaluation.html   More

@article{ han95evaluation,
    author = "Jiawei Han and Laks V. S. Lakshmanan",
    title = "Evaluation of Regular Nonlinear Recursions by Deductive Database Techniques",
    journal = "Information Systems",
    volume = "20",
    number = "5",
    pages = "419--441",
    year = "1995",
    url = "citeseer.ist.psu.edu/article/han95evaluation.html" }
Citations (may not include all citations):
981   Principles of Database and Knowledge-Base Systems (context) - Ullman - 1989
561   Constraint logic programming (context) - Jaffar, Lassez - 1987
440   The Art of Prolog (context) - Sterling, Shapiro - 1986
413   Logical foundations of object-oriented and frame-based langu.. - Kifer, Lausen et al. - 1993
204   Magic sets and other strange ways to implement logic program.. (context) - Bancilhon, Maier et al. - 1986
204   Querying object-oriented database - Kifer, Kim et al. - 1992
147   An amateur's introduction to recursive query processing stra.. (context) - Bancilhon, Ramakrishnan - 1986
121   the power of magic - Beeri, Ramakrishnan - 1987
115   Magic templates: A spellbinding approach to logic programs - Ramakrishnan - 1988
101   Hilog: A foundation for higher-order logic programming - Chen, Kifer et al. - 1993
46   Query evaluation in recursive databases: Bottom-up and top-d.. (context) - Bry - 1990
44   Efficient tests for top-down termination of logical rules (context) - Ullman, van Gelder - 1988
30   Intelligent query answering in rule based systems (context) - Imielinski - 1987
28   Expanding query power in constraint logic programming langua.. (context) - Maher, Stuckey - 1989
28   Proof-tree transformation theorems and their applications (context) - Ramakrishnan, Sagiv et al. - 1989
27   Termination detection in logic programs using argument sizes (context) - Sohn, van Gelder - 1991
27   Efficient transitive closure algorithms (context) - Ioannidis, Ramakrishnan - 1988
27   Safety of recursive Horn clauses with infinite relations (context) - Ramakrishnan, Bancilhon et al. - 1987
27   On compiling queries in recursive first-order databases (context) - Henschen, Naqvi - 1984
26   Efficient evaluation of right (context) - Naughton, Ramakrishnan et al. - 1989
25   Inference of inequality constraints in logic programs (context) - Brodsky, Sagiv - 1991
22   Deriving constraints among argument sizes in logic programs (context) - van Gelder - 1990
20   Propagating constraints in recursive deductive databases - Kemp, Ramamohanarao et al. - 1989
19   A framework for testing safety and effective computability o.. (context) - Krishnamurthy, Ramakrishnan et al. - 1988
16   A suitable algorithm for computing partial transitive closur.. (context) - Jiang - 1990
15   Bounds on the propagation of selection into logic programs (context) - Beeri, Kanellakis et al. - 1987
15   Termination proofs for logic programs based on predicate ine.. (context) - Plumer - 1990
14   From QSQ towards QoSaQ: Global optimization of recursive que.. (context) - Vieille - 1988
14   Deductive databases in action (context) - Tsur - 1991
11   LogicBase: A deductive database system prototype - Han, Liu et al. - 1994
11   Necessary and sufficient condition to linearize doubly recur.. (context) - Zhang, Yu et al. - 1990
10   Knowledge and Data Engineering (context) - Chimenti, Gamboa et al. - 1990
10   Optimization in a logic based language for knowledge and dat.. (context) - Krishnamurthy, Zaniolo - 1988
10   Safety of datalog queries over infinite databases (context) - Sagiv, Vardi - 1989
9   On termination of datalog programs (context) - Brodsky, Sagiv - 1989
8   Compiling separable recursions (context) - Naughton - 1988
7   Constraint-based reasoning in deductive databases (context) - Han - 1991
7   Automatic generation of compiled forms for linear recursions (context) - Han, Zeng - 1992
6   A Logical Data Language for Data and Knowledge Bases (context) - Naqvi, Tsur - 1989
6   Linearising nonlinear recursions in polynomial time (context) - Saraiya - 1989
4   Compilation-based list processing in deductive databases (context) - Han - 1992
3   Homomorphic tree embeddings and their applications to recurs.. - Lakshmanan, Ashraf et al. - 1993
2   An axiomatic approach to deciding finiteness of queries in d.. (context) - Kifer, Ramakrishnan et al. - 1988

Documents on the same site (http://www.cs.concordia.ca/~faculty/laks/papers.html):   More
An Epistemic Foundation for Logic Programming with Uncertainty - Lakshmanan (1994)   (Correct)
nD-SQL: A Multi-dimensional Language for Interoperability and .. - Gingras, Lakshmanan (1998)   (Correct)
Canonical Kripke Models and The Intuitionistic Semantics of.. - Dong, al. (1993)   (Correct)

Online articles have much greater impact   More about CiteSeer.IST   Add search form to your site   Submit documents   Feedback  

CiteSeer.IST - Copyright Penn State and NEC